Coalition Aircraft Strike Zarqawi Stronghold

When You Care Enough To (Keep) Sending The Very Best!

Coalition aircraft hit a stronghold of fugitive terrorist Abu Musab al-Zarqawi outside Fallujah, Iraq, Sunday.

Forces attacked the site using precision-guided munitions.

News reports indicate 14 people were killed and three injured, but a coalition statement did not include casualty figures.

Zarqawi, a Jordanian extremist, has claimed responsibility for many of the terrorist strikes in Iraq, including the explosions that destroyed the U.N. headquarters in the country and strikes against Kurdish targets. Zarqawi hopes to incite civil war in Iraq, U.S. officials said, citing a letter he wrote to al Qaeda leaders that was intercepted last year.

Military officials said Iraqi Prime Minister Iyad Allawi approved the strike. The strike destroyed a house and fighting positions around it, according to a written statement from coalition deputy operations chief Army Brig. Gen. Erv Lessel. The release said about 25 foreign fighters were in the house before the strike. [ANN Thanks the American Forces Press Service]
